Anesthesiologists in Anderson, Indiana are projected to earn a median annual salary of $365,091 in 2026, which is notably lower than the national median of $409,107. The salary range for this role varies significantly, from $211,753 at the 10th percentile to $533,376 at the 90th percentile. These numbers reflect the local market conditions and have been estimated based on 2025 BLS OEWS data. The sharp disparity in compensation is often driven by the call burden associated with anesthesia practice; factors such as case volume, subspecialty fellowship, and whether one is in a W-2 hospital employment versus a private partnership can greatly influence earnings. Anesthesiologist Job Market in Anderson
As of 2025, there are 11 anesthesiologists employed in Anderson, indicating a limited but stable job market for this specialty. The cost of living in the area is relatively low, with a cost-of-living index of 91.3, meaning that take-home pay can stretch further than in higher-cost locations. Major employers include hospital systems and private anesthesia group practices, each offering different compensation packages; hospital-employed anesthesiologists typically have a more predictable salary while private practices might include partnership tracks that could lead to higher earnings. A significant factor in narrowing the salary range is the call burden—those working in Q3 rotations may earn less than their Q5 counterparts due to workload differences.
